Magic Kingdom Outlines 2026 Overhaul With Big Thunder’s Return, Buzz Revamp and Higher Prices
Layered updates prioritize preservation of classics over wholesale replacement.
Overview
- Big Thunder Mountain Railroad is slated to reopen in spring 2026 after an extended closure, restoring a key anchor in Frontierland.
- Buzz Lightyear’s attraction receives new ride vehicles, upgraded hand blasters, more reliable targets, an added scene, and a new character named Buddy.
- Rivers of America remains an active construction zone through 2026 to support the future Piston Peak expansion, with rerouted walkways and altered sightlines.
- Cinderella Castle will shift to a blue-and-gray color scheme, and Carousel of Progress will add a new Walt Disney Audio-Animatronic in the pre-show.
- Peak-day tickets at Magic Kingdom surpass $200 in 2026 and Disney After Hours is scheduled January through July, as infrastructure work continues in Frontierland and at the future Villains Land.
